Installation instructions Installation instructions To reduce the risk of fire or burns caused by reaching over heated surface units, locating cabinet storage space above these units should be avoided. If cabinet storage or a range hood is provided, distance A must be at least 30" (75 cm). A range hood has to extend at least 5" (12,5 cm) beyond the front of the cabinets. 18
